Installing the front-panel assembly

To install the front-panel assembly, complete the following steps:

1. Position the front end of the front-panel assembly in the channel above drive

bay 1 on the left side of the chassis.

2. Push the front-panel assembly toward the front of the chassis until it clicks into

place.

3. Reroute and connect the front-panel assembly cable to the system board (see

“System board internal connectors” on page 10 for the location of the
front-panel connector).

4. If the server has hot-swap power supplies, install the power supply cage and

the power supplies (see “Installing the hot-swap power supply cage” on page
105).

5. Push the drives in bay 1 and bay 2 into the drive bays (see “Installing a CD or

DVD drive” on page 73 for more information).

6. Install the upper bezel (see “Installing the upper bezel” on page 67).

7. Install the lower bezel (see “Installing the lower bezel” on page 65).

8. Install the side cover (see “Installing the side cover” on page 63).

9. Lock the side cover if you unlocked it during removal.

10. Reconnect the external cables and power cords; then, turn on the attached

devices and turn on the server.

Removing the front USB connector assembly

To remove the front USB connector assembly, complete the following steps:

1. Read the safety information that begins on page vii and “Installation guidelines”

on page 57.

2. Turn off the server and all attached devices; then, disconnect all power cords

and external cables.

3. Unlock and remove the side cover (see “Removing the side cover” on page

62).

4. Remove the lower bezel (see “Removing the lower bezel” on page 64).

5. Remove the upper bezel (see “Removing the upper bezel” on page 66).

6. Disconnect the front USB cable from the system board, and note the routing of

the cable (see “System board internal connectors” on page 10 for the location
of the front USB connector).

7. Press down and hold the release tab on the top of the front USB housing;

then, tilt the top of the housing away from the chassis and lift the housing out
of the opening in the chassis.
